Post-holidays I find that most of my clients just need to move and sweat so we’ve been focusing on cardio-intensive workouts with bodyweight/lightweight strength intervals. My go-to has been either treadmill or row sprints mixed in with high-rep bodyweight/kettlebell/lightweight movements.

This rowing workout has been a winner with my clients this week.

30REPWORKOUT

It’s a really easy workout format that alternates 500 meter rows with 30 reps of various simple (but tough!) movements. You end up rowing 2,000 meter total (I like to equate that to about a mile on the treadmill) and doing 150 reps of various exercises. My clients finished somewhere in the 20-25ish minute range. If you don’t have access to a rower, sub in 400 meter runs (0.25 miles).
